Key Concepts
- Request for Proposal (RFP): A formal document detailing business requirements and evaluation criteria.
- Service Level Agreements (SLAs): Legally binding standards for vendor service delivery, uptime, response times, and compliance.
- Italian Financial Regulation: Includes MiFID II, CONSOB directives, GDPR, and local supervisory authorities affecting FinTech providers.
- Wealth Management & Asset Management Integration: Coordination between technology solutions and financial advisory to enhance portfolio allocation and client engagement.

How Wealth Management FinTech Company RFP Questions—Service & SLAs Italy Works
Step-by-Step Tutorials & Proven Strategies:
- Define Business Needs: Identify key pain points, regulatory requirements, and growth goals.
- Draft Comprehensive RFP Questions: Cover technology, compliance, data security, SLA terms, scalability, and customer service.
- Select RFP Recipients: Target FinTechs specializing in wealth management and Italian market expertise.
- Evaluate Responses: Utilize a scoring matrix focusing on SLA adherence, service uptime, and regulatory alignment.
- Conduct Vendor Demos & Interviews: Validate capabilities and confirm SLA terms.
- Negotiate SLAs: Detail service levels, KPIs, penalty clauses, and reporting mechanisms.
- Finalize Contract: Ensure legal review aligning with Italian financial laws.
- Implement & Monitor: Use continuous SLA tracking and feedback loops.
Best Practices for Implementation:
- Customize RFP questions for local Italian regulations such as GDPR and MiFID II.
- Include all stakeholders: compliance teams, IT, and client service.
- Use data analytics to benchmark vendors’ historical SLA performance.
- Document risk management strategies within SLA agreements.
- Incorporate flexibility clauses to adapt SLAs with evolving technology standards.

Q1: What are the critical RFP questions to include for wealth management FinTechs in Italy?
A: Focus on compliance with MiFID II, GDPR, service uptime, security protocols, and SLA penalties. Evaluate vendor flexibility and scalability.
Q2: How do SLAs impact regulatory compliance in wealth management?
A: SLAs formalize response times, data protection measures, and audit capabilities that uphold regulatory standards.

Q5: What service metrics define an effective SLA?
A: Metrics such as system uptime (>99.9%), response times (≤30 mins), transaction accuracy, and disaster recovery speed are essential.
